Fonts & Graphics Required :
Include all screen and printer fonts (Suitcase and Postscript fonts)
or convert type to outlines, Include all link files,i,e..,EPS files and
their originals, TIFFs, PICTs, and Photoshop documents. Scanned
images must be a minimum of 300 dpi resolution. Save your
image as CMYK, DUOTONE or GRAYSCALE.

Colors:
- Properly define colors as process (CMYK) or spot (PMS).
- Pay attention to whether colors are set to knock out or overprint.
- Delete unused colors.
- Properly indicate and apply special colors.
Graphic Design Guidelines
Minimum Standards: for best results, do not go below these
recommendations: Rules: .5 pt (.007 in. ). Type: positive: 4 pt
sans serif knocked-out, 5 pt. sans serif & 8 pt. serif. Print to die
position: .0625" away from edge of die. Color trap: .5 pt ( .007" ).
Screen: 2 % to 100 %. We cannot print less than 2 % of any color
in blends. Scanned images must be at resolution of 300 dpi.

Helpful reminders for art departments on color
separation issues
- Before sending us the file: If you know that the job is going to
be Pantone or spot colors make sure that you don't have any
other colors other than your Pantone colors that you are using.
We suggest laser printing your color separations to ensure that
you don't have unexpected spot colors. If we encounter an
unusual situation. you will be charged extra for artwork,
diagnosis, and problem solving.
- Be sure to convert any scanned color image to CMYK before
saving it.
- Always send the fonts, screen and printer fonts, in any case.
